One of the most common types of insulator products is the insulating material used in electrical systems. These materials are designed to prevent the flow of electricity through unwanted paths, thereby reducing the risk of electrical shock and other hazards. Insulating materials can come in many forms, including rubber, plastic, glass, and ceramic. Each material has its own unique properties and advantages, making it suitable for different applications.

Rubber insulating materials, for example, are commonly used in electrical wires and cables to provide a barrier between the conductive wires and the surrounding environment. Rubber is an excellent insulator because it is flexible, durable, and resistant to heat and chemicals. This makes it ideal for use in a wide range of applications, from household appliances to industrial machinery.

Plastic insulating materials are another popular choice for electrical applications. Plastics are lightweight, easy to work with, and cost-effective, making them a practical option for insulating wires, cables, and other electrical components. Plastic insulators are also resistant to moisture, which is important for outdoor and wet environments.

Glass insulators are commonly used in high-voltage electrical systems to provide a strong and durable barrier between conductive components. Glass is an excellent insulator because it is transparent, allowing for easy inspection of the electrical connections. Glass insulators are also immune to chemical corrosion and can withstand high temperatures, making them suitable for demanding industrial applications.

Ceramic insulators are another type of insulating material commonly used in electrical systems. Ceramic is a non-conductive material that is resistant to high temperatures, making it ideal for use in high-voltage applications. Ceramic insulators are also durable and long-lasting, making them a reliable choice for industrial machinery and equipment.

In addition to insulating materials, insulator products also include a variety of other components that are essential for maintaining the safety and efficiency of industrial processes. insulator products can include insulating blankets, gloves, mats, and other protective gear that help to prevent electrical shock and other hazards.

Insulating blankets are commonly used in electrical maintenance and repair work to protect workers from accidental contact with live wires and other electrical components. Insulating gloves are also essential for workers who handle live electrical equipment, providing a barrier between the hands and the potentially dangerous electrical currents.

Insulating mats are another important type of insulator product that is used to protect workers from electric shock in hazardous environments. Insulating mats are placed on the floor around electrical equipment to provide a safe and non-conductive surface for workers to stand on. This helps to reduce the risk of accidents and injuries in industrial settings.
